Chemical Communications | 2003

In situ UV-visible assessment of extent of reduction during oxidation reactions on oxide catalysts

Morris D. Argyle; Kaidong Chen; Carlo Resini; Catherine Krebs; Alexis T. Bell; Enrique Iglesia

The extent of reduction of active centers during oxidative alkane dehydrogenation on VOx/Al2O3 was measured from pre-edge UV-visible spectral features and found to increase with increasing VOx domain size and propane/O2 ratio.
